Part 1 starts with explaining the history of SPFx, its capabilities, and the core building blocks around it, including SharePoint, Microsoft 365, Teams, and so on. It also details how to set SPFx up on your local machine to begin the development. In this part, we also outline a technical solution based on fictitious requirements, which will enable us to demonstrate a specific functionality in each subsequent chapter offered by SPFx through practical business examples.
